Transaction 8a6d9917e76a0f7e1648ddb28fb31b122ab267b4e1de8c3929ff32a8e6821198

367 Input
2 Outputs
  • 8a6d9917e76a0f7e1648ddb28fb31b122ab267b4e1de8c3929ff32a8e6821198:0
  • value  989302
    address  3LGKLkJJoQuLbYS82CaBjsSp1PYtcvjLAF
  • 8a6d9917e76a0f7e1648ddb28fb31b122ab267b4e1de8c3929ff32a8e6821198:1
  • value  5235273530
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s